Dancing Around


I'm trying to educate people who condemn others, as best I can with a just a lousy online presence. #ASL is not English, nor is it any other spoken language. It has its own syntax & grammar rules. It is not "dancing around" (unless we need to). CC isn't perfect (especially when live).

My Lucky Wiener

A few years back in 2005 I was driving home one night after work & I had taken my hearing aids off (like I usually do). The radio was on & I heard this new song I was getting into when suddenly I thought I heard the singer going ♫My lucky wiener♪ ?!?

I couldn't make it out. I thought "that can't possibly be it", so I turned the volume up some more. Again, same thing. The DJ never said who the artist was & I almost forgot about it completely.

It was some time later I had the TV set on VH-1 & that song started playing, I had to chuckle, my HoH ears had done it to me again. The band was the Killers & it turns out the chorus & title of the song was actually "Smile Like You Mean It."
